I need another pump. My current pump is an 815 with an inline head. Is there any downside to center-inlet pumps? I can't think of any reason to get the inline models anymore and will probably just get center-inlet models from now on. Any advice appreciated.
 
Some people don't like the fact that the inlet is 3/4" NPT instead of 1/2" NPT (but the flow rate is still better even if you immediately reduce to 1/2"). It costs a couple bucks more. Obviously it'll impact your plumbing layout, but that could be a positive or a negative, depending on your setup. Aside from that, no downsides that I'm aware of.
